“Wailing Wailers” Acting Like Kids Whose Lollipop Has Been Taken – Femi Adesina

Femi Adesina, the special adviser on media and publicity to President Muhammadu Buhari who described critics of his principal  as “wailing wailers” again took his disdain for government critics a notch higher when he said the “wailing wailers” were acting like kids whose lollipop has been taken from them.

Adesina was speaking on Buhari’s failure to visit Agatu communities after the herdsmen massacre. Adesina said the president already reacted to the massacre in a statement. He added that Buhari is not a talkative.

He then called on the citizens who he described as wailers to stop wailing and support the president in attaining enduring change.

“The wailing wailers, you’d see that I used that expression not quite a month or two into the life of the administration,” he said.

“Now, how will a new administration…and maybe whenever the president says something, you just start hearing noise, wah, wah, wah, wah, like a child whose lollipop has been taken away.

“They didn’t want to give an opportunity for the government, and that was why I said why are they wailing like wailers.

“Mr president has no other things he does than to serve Nigeria. What can the people do? The people can support him; the wailing wailers should stop wailing and rather begin to encourage.”

Adesina recently came under public attacks after a reckless comment which asked Nigerian citizens to go and face the vandalizers of pipeline infrastructure which was responsible for declining power supply in the country.
